The concept is to strip out the internals of a graphing calculator and replace them with an Orange Pi that runs Android. Ideally, it would boot directly into a calculator mode but also be capable of running Android apps and browsing the web, allowing for access to ChatGPT and images.

I do have some concerns, though. One is that the Orange Pi might be too large to fit inside the calculator. Additionally, my lack of coding experience could make this project quite challenging.

  1. Your idea of replacing a graphing calculator’s internals with an Orange Pi running Android is certainly creative and technically intriguing! Here’s a breakdown of what’s required to make it happen, along with potential challenges:

    Equipment Needed:

    1. Orange Pi: A compact version, like the Orange Pi Zero or Orange Pi Lite, might be more suitable due to size constraints.
    2. Power Supply: A mini USB or battery solution for the Orange Pi.
    3. Display: If the existing display isn’t compatible, you may need a small LCD display that connects to the Orange Pi.
    4. Input Method: Either adapt the existing keypad or use an external input method (like a touchscreen).
    5. Casing Material: Depending on how you want to enclose your project, you might need 3D printing services or custom casing solutions.
    6. Cables and Connectors: For power, display, and any input devices.
    7. Breadboard/Prototyping Board: For initial tests of circuits, if needed.
    8. Cooling Solution: Depending on how much power the Orange Pi uses, you might consider a small fan.

    Knowledge Required:

    1. Basic Electronics: Understanding of power requirements, wiring, and circuitry.
    2. Soldering Skills: You may need to solder wires or connections on the Orange Pi or other components.
    3. Coding Skills: Familiarity with Android app development (Java/Kotlin) or at least using existing apps in a customized launcher.
    4. Operating System Configuration: Knowledge of how to configure the Orange Pi to boot into a specific mode or app.
    5. 3D Design (optional): If you opt to create a custom casing.

    Challenges:

    • Size Limitations: The Orange Pi might be too large for the existing calculator case. You might need to design a new enclosure to accommodate it.
    • Battery Life: Ensuring sufficient battery life for practical use could be challenging, especially if using Bluetooth or Wi-Fi.
    • Integration Complexity: The integration of hardware (buttons, screens) with the software may require significant troubleshooting.
    • Software Development: If you’re not familiar with coding, you may find it challenging to customize or even use a launcher to boot into the calculator mode.

    Recommendations:

    • Start Small: Before modifying a graphing calculator, consider experimenting with an Orange Pi on its own. Set up a basic project that runs Android apps to get comfortable with the platform.
    • Online Resources: Leverage tutorials, forums, and communities centered around Raspberry Pi or Orange Pi projects.
    • Collaborate: If coding is a major blockage, consider collaborating with someone who has programming experience or look for tutorials that guide you through the necessary setups.
